This plaque is located at the corner of a parking lot for a Shaw's supermarket, near the northeast corner of the building. The marker reads:
"Samuel Sparhawk House stood 170 feet south from this spot
Demolished 1898
In this house Colonel Thomas Gardner died July 3 1775 after receiving a mortal wound at the Battle of Bunker Hill
Erected by the City of Boston - August 3, 1907"
